Highly Skilled Java Developer

3 days ago


Toronto, Ontario, Canada Tata Consultancy Services Full time

Explore a dynamic career at Tata Consultancy Services, where innovation meets expertise. As a Telecommute Senior Java Engineer, you'll be part of our team transforming businesses worldwide.

About Us

Tata Consultancy Services (TCS) is a leading IT services, consulting, and business solutions organization with over 55 years of experience. We partner with top global businesses in their transformation journeys, offering a unique combination of consulting-led, cognitive-powered services and solutions.

Our commitment to diversity and inclusion is reflected in our workplace policies and processes, making us an equal opportunity employer for individuals from all backgrounds.

Career Opportunities

We're seeking an experienced Java professional with strong skills in Java v8, v11, and related technologies such as Spring JDBC, Hibernate, JPA, and Async APIs. You should have hands-on experience with SQL databases and Oracle databases, as well as DevOps practices.

A good understanding of the banking domain and prior experience working with Rest API frameworks are beneficial, but not essential. Our ideal candidate will have around 5-10 years of IT experience and a passion for staying up-to-date with industry trends.

Key Responsibilities
  • Design, develop, and maintain scalable Java applications
  • Collaborate with cross-functional teams to implement innovative solutions
  • Work on diverse projects, including those related to banking and finance

This role requires excellent problem-solving skills, attention to detail, and the ability to work independently or as part of a team.

What We Offer

TCS offers a competitive salary range of $120,000 - $180,000 per year, depending on location and experience. In addition to a comprehensive benefits package, we provide opportunities for growth and development, flexible work arrangements, and a supportive work environment that fosters collaboration and innovation.

We are committed to meeting the accessibility needs of all individuals and strive to create an inclusive workplace culture. If you're passionate about technology, eager to learn, and looking for a challenging yet rewarding career, join us at TCS Canada Inc.



  • Toronto, Ontario, Canada Tata Consultancy Services Full time

    Company OverviewTata Consultancy Services is a leading IT services, consulting, and business solutions organization with over 55 years of experience in partnering with top businesses for their transformation journeys.We strive to create a workforce that reflects the diverse societies we operate in, embracing equality and inclusivity through our equitable...


  • Toronto, Ontario, Canada Genpact Full time

    About Genpact">Genpact is a dynamic and innovative company with a startup spirit. Our team of over 90,000 curious and courageous minds has the expertise to work with big brands.We harness technology and humanity to create meaningful transformation that drives progress. We're looking for thinkers and doers who share our passion for learning and growth.The...


  • Toronto, Ontario, Canada Iris Software Inc. Full time

    Iris Software Inc. is a renowned Fortune 100 company seeking an exceptional Java Full Stack Developer for a long-term engagement based in Toronto, ON.Estimated Salary: $150,000 - $200,000 per annumAbout the Role:This pivotal position involves designing, developing, and deploying distributed cloud applications using Java 8+ and Spring Framework (Spring Boot)....


  • Toronto, Ontario, Canada NearSource Full time

    NearSource Technologies is an innovative company that offers a range of technology services. Our salary for this position is approximately $140,000 per year.Job DescriptionWe are excited to announce an opening for a Senior Java Developer position. This is a full-time, fully remote role, allowing you the flexibility to work from anywhere. Below is the...


  • Toronto, Ontario, Canada Equality Street Inc. Full time

    Job Title:Highly Experienced Java Developer for Cloud-based Projects

  • Java Developer

    3 weeks ago


    Toronto, Ontario, C6A, Ontario, Canada Vectorsoft Full time

    We are looking for a highly skilled Senior Java Developer with expertise in Java internals, the Spring Framework, and REST API development to design and optimize complex software systems. The candidate should possess a deep understanding of advanced Java features, modern application design patterns, and best practices for scalability and...


  • Toronto, Ontario, Canada NearSource Full time

    About UsNearSource Technologies is a renowned company based in Toronto, Ontario.Located in the heart of Toronto, we offer a unique blend of urban and natural environments.Our VisionWe aim to push the boundaries of technology and innovation, creating cutting-edge solutions that transform industries.Job DescriptionWe are seeking a highly skilled Senior Backend...


  • Toronto, Ontario, Canada Capgemini Full time

    At Capgemini, we are seeking a highly experienced and skilled Back-End Developer to join our dynamic team and lead the development of scalable, high-performance back-end applications.This client-facing role involves significant interaction with key client stakeholders, ensuring the alignment of technical solutions with client needs. The ideal candidate will...


  • Toronto, Ontario, Canada NearSource Full time

    Job SummaryWe are seeking a talented Software Developer II to contribute to our team and help shape the future of technology.Key Responsibilities:Develop and maintain scalable software localization and testing tools, automated workflows, and comprehensive documentation.Stay up-to-date on industry trends and emerging technologies to anticipate future...


  • Toronto, Ontario, Canada BeachHead Full time

    OverviewBeachHead is a leading agency that provides exceptional services to top financial clients. We are seeking an experienced Integration Specialist- Java/Powershell to join our team.Estimated Salary Range$120,000 - $180,000 per year, based on industry standards and location.Job DescriptionThis role requires an individual with extensive experience in...


  • Toronto, Ontario, Canada Royal Bank of Canada Full time

    About the RoleWe are seeking a highly experienced Senior Java Development Manager to lead our Java development team in Toronto, Canada. As a key member of our team, you will be responsible for designing, developing, and implementing complex applications using Java technologies.Key ResponsibilitiesLead and mentor a team of software developers to ensure their...


  • Toronto, Ontario, Canada NearSource Full time

    At NearSource Technologies, we are committed to innovation and excellence in the field of technology. With a presence in Toronto, Ontario, our team is constantly striving for forward-thinking solutions that push the boundaries of what is possible.We are seeking a Technical Lead in Java Development to join our team and contribute their expertise to an...

  • Sr. Java Developer

    1 month ago


    Greater Toronto Area, Canada, Ontario Globant Full time

    Senior Java Developer Overview: We are seeking a skilled Senior Java Developer to join our team in developing a highly scalable library for method orchestration and execution in a distributed computing environment, leveraging AWS cloud infrastructure. This role involves working with cutting-edge architecture, similar to a MapReduce framework, where tasks are...


  • Toronto, Ontario, Canada Genpact Full time

    As a Senior Java Engineer at Genpact, you will be part of a dynamic team that harnesses the power of technology and humanity to create meaningful transformation.With over 90,000 curious and courageous minds, we have the expertise to go deep with the world's biggest brands. Our startup spirit drives us to reinvent the ways companies work, making an impact far...


  • Toronto, Ontario, Canada Cognizioni IT Solutions LLC Full time

    Cognizioni IT Solutions LLC Job OpportunityWe are seeking a highly skilled Senior Java Developer Leader to join our team.About the Role:As a Senior Java Developer Leader, you will be responsible for leading a team of software developers and engineers in the design, development, and maintenance of existing applications and introduction of additional...


  • Toronto, Ontario, Canada S.i. Systèmes Full time

    S.i. Systèmes is seeking a highly skilled Senior COBOL Developer to join our team in Toronto or Scarborough.About the RoleWe are looking for an experienced developer with a strong background in host/mainframe development, including COBOL, JCL, ACF, Endevor, DB2, and IMS. As a Senior COBOL Developer, you will be responsible for overseeing changes and...


  • Toronto, Ontario, Canada S.i. Systems Full time

    At S.i. Systems, we are seeking a highly skilled and experienced Java Developer to join our team.About the RoleWe are looking for an expert in Java development with strong experience in Springboot, Microservices design/development, and Cloud infrastructure. The ideal candidate will have a deep understanding of software development lifecycle, including agile...


  • Toronto, Ontario, Canada Royal Bank of Canada Full time

    Royal Bank of Canada is seeking a highly skilled Senior Java Developer to join our team in Toronto. This role will be responsible for designing and implementing strategic solutions using Java, REST microservices, and Kubernetes Cloud deployments.In this position, you will have the opportunity to work on high-performance applications with Oracle and MongoDB...


  • Toronto, Ontario, Ontario, Canada Stefanini North America and APAC Full time

    Job Title: Java Full Stack Developer Location: Toronto, Canada About the Role: We are seeking a highly skilled Java Full Stack Developer to join our dynamic team. The ideal candidate will have a strong foundation in Java, Spring Boot, and Angular. Experience with Google Cloud Platform (GCP) is a significant advantage. As a Full Stack Developer, you will be...


  • Toronto, Ontario, Canada Royal Bank of Canada Full time

    We are seeking a highly skilled and experienced test automation lead to join our team at Royal Bank of Canada. This is an excellent opportunity for a professional with a strong background in software testing, particularly in the area of test automation.About the RoleThis position will play a critical role in leading the development and implementation of...